A handmade gift is a gift from the heart. The envelope for this beautiful Victorian card is made with a woven paper crafting technique that seems intricate, but is pretty simple in execution. Tips for making a beautiful handmade Victorian card for your mother.

Preparation
    • Computer with document software and printer
    • Ruler Pencil Scissors
    • 2 (12" square) decorative sheets of paper for envelope
    • 1 (8 1/2" X 11") sheet cardstock Victorian scrapbook embellishments (sticker, buttons, bows)
    • Adhesive products (Zots 3-D glue dots, double-stick tape, white glue)

Steps
  • To make the envelope pattern, open your document program and type the capital letter "U". Highlight the "U" and select the Century Gothic font at 500 points. Print it on a sheet of white paper from your computer.

  • Mark the "U" so that it is 4 1/2 inches long. Then, use a ruler to draw a line across the width of the "U" at the 4 1/2-inch length mark (photo Step 2).

    Cut around the outer rounded part of the "U" and across the straight part, trimming it 4 1/2 inches long. Do not cut along the interior line of the "U".

  • Divide the "U" into 3 equal sections across the width. Use a ruler to draw 2 lines from the straight part up to 3/4-inch from the rounded part of the "U". Cut slits along these lines starting from the straight part - do not cut through the rounded part (photo Step 3).

    You've made the heart envelope pattern!

  • Fold the decorative paper in half. Place the pattern on the paper, lining up the pattern's straight edge with the decorative paper's fold.

  • Trace the outer edge of the pattern ( photo Step 5) and trace the 2 cut lines in the slits. Cut out the pattern from the decorative paper. Repeat the process with the other sheet of decorative paper.

  • Refer to the video for this step. Start with 2 outside strips on each decorative paper piece (photo Step 6).

    Weave the strips together in an over under pattern. But, make sure the you insert the strips inside each other with each weave. For example, in photo Step 6:

    The floral "weaving" strip is inserted into the green strip.

    Then, the middle green strip would be inserted into the floral "weaving" strip.

    Finally, the floral "weaving" strip would be inserting into the last green strip.

  • For the next row, start by inserting the green strip into the floral strip, or the opposite of what you did for the first row, to create the woven look. Continue weaving strips until you've finished the woven heart envelope.

  • Place the envelope on the cardstock and trace it. Cut the heart shape out of the cardstock.

  • Decorate the envelope and card insert with Victorian-style embellishments. Slip the card into the envelope and give it to mom on Mother's Day.
